Advances in Female Fertility Medicine: Hope for Every Woman

Recent progress in female fertility medicine are offering unprecedented hope to women facing challenges conceiving. From innovative interventions to cutting-edge methods, medical science is continually pushing the boundaries of what's possible, providing a wider range of possibilities for individuals seeking to build their families.

One notable area of progress is in assisted reproductive treatments, such as in vitro fertilization (IVF). With refinements in egg extraction techniques and embryo evaluation, IVF success rates are steadily rising. Furthermore, advances in genetic testing allow for analysis of potential chromosomal abnormalities, enabling more informed treatment decisions.

Beyond medical interventions, lifestyle adjustments also play a crucial role in optimizing female fertility. Experts now emphasize the importance of maintaining Fertility Specialist Doctor a healthy physique, engaging in regular workouts, and reducing stress levels through techniques like mindfulness. These holistic approaches can substantially enhance a woman's chances of becoming pregnant.

Navigating Male Infertility: Seeking Expert Care

When facing the challenge of male infertility, seeking expert care becomes paramount. A skilled healthcare professional can support you through a meticulous evaluation to pinpoint the underlying origin of your infertility.

Consultations with a urologist are often the first step. They will perform a thorough medical history review, assessment, and potentially order tests such as a spermogram to evaluate your sperm quality.

Ultimately, understanding the distinct type of your male infertility is crucial for creating a personalized treatment that enhances your chances of achieving parenthood.
